The SysAid REST API was designed to help:

  • Display, store, and process help desk data in a way that is best for your organization

  • Interface SysAid with third-party applications

The REST API is supported by SysAid versions 15.4 and up

This guide is for Web Developers/IT Professional programmers and assumes an advanced understanding of computer protocols to best utilize the APIs to your organization's advantage.

This document assumes knowledge of how to program REST API calls using your programming language and selected technology in your System Environment settings.

Request Limits

The following request limits apply when using SysAid's REST API to ensure high uptime, good performance, and increased self-sufficiency in meeting growing usage demands, without requiring assistance from the SysAid Customer Care team:

  • A maximum of two API login requests will be allowed within a five-minute period

  • Up to 1,000 other API requests will be allowed within a five-minute period

If usage exceeds the framework, an HTTP 429 message appears, and you will be able to continue once that five-minute time period has passed.

Definitions

There are several definitions that you should be familiar with before you read the rest of this guide.

SysAid Entity (Object)

A SysAid entity is anything in SysAid that has both a list page and a form page. Each SysAid entity is represented by a SysAid object.

The API gives you access to the following SysAid entities: service records, assets, CIs, and users.

Endpoint

When you use the API, the endpoint should be appended to your account URL as in the following example:

https://www.johndoe.sysaid.com/api/v1/<api_url>

Common Parameters

The following parameters are available in all or most of the API calls.

Offset

If you are retrieving a list of items, you can use the Offset parameter to set where on the list you should begin. For example, if you are retrieving a list of service records and there are 500 that match your criteria, but you are not interested in the first 100, you can set the Offset to 101 so the API returns service records 101 and up.

Limit
The maximum number of items to retrieve. For example, if your API call retrieves 1000 assets, you can set the limit to 300 so that only the first 300 assets (beginning from the defined offset, if specified) are retrieved.

View
A SysAid view that defines the available fields. Such views can be selected and set for lists in SysAid. You can create or customize views from the SysAid admin web interface.

Fields

Define a list of comma-separated values representing the field names you want to retrieve. If this parameter is set together with the View parameter, the API call returns both View fields and the fields specified in this parameter.

Info
Additional information fields.

Login

This Login call is for non-OAuth users.

Command Name

Command

Description

More Details

Authenticate a user on the SysAid server

POST/login

Checks that the user is an administrator and that they have permissions to access the mobile app

More Details

Important!

Upon a successful login, the API consumer needs to retrieve the JSESSIONID cookie from the Response Header and submit it in all subsequent API Request Headers.

For security reasons, each session expires after 24 hours.
Please make sure to log in again before the session expires.

Please note:

For Cloud accounts:


Subsequent API Calls for SysAid Cloud Accounts need to include:

  • An Additional Cookie named SERVERID

  • The Additional Cookie's value, which is returned from the Login response

Appendix A: Field Types

Field TypeDescription
text

A textual value

numericA numeric value
booleanBoolean value - can be either 0/1, or true/false
dateA date value. Returned as milliseconds in UTC/GMT (since January 1, 1970). The valueCaption is the formatted date representation, according to date display configuration in SysAid.
listA list of values. The full list of values can be retrieved using the /list/{id} api call.
nestedThe value is an item in a nested list. Currently used for category levels.
objectThe value is an object with sub values.

Appendix B: Lists

The available lists are fetched by entity types.
For example, if you want to retrieve all available lists in the Service Record form, you can send the following API call:
/list?entity=sr

The available lists are:

List TypeDescription
srService record related lists
assetAsset related lists
userUser related lists
ciCI related lists
companyCompany related lists
action_itemAction item related lists
projectService record Sub Tabs lists
taskTask related lists
catalogCatalog related lists
softwareSoftware related lists
sr_activityService Record activity related lists
supplierSupplier related lists
task_activityTask activity related lists
user_groupsUser Group related lists
